Basic Plumbing Tools You Should Have on Hand
Property owners need to be furnished for plumbing emergency situations in instance of abrupt troubles with their plumbing components. It is consequently essential to have some standard plumbing devices. Utilizing the finest plumbing tools will give you the called for outcomes as well as of program, makes easy DIY plumbing fixings feasible.

Auger:


This is likewise known as a drainpipe serpent and is made use of for removing drain obstructions. This device is inserted right into blocked drains pipes to pull out clogs and gunk from the drainpipe. You placed it in the drainpipe as well as twist it to damage obstructions into tinier bits for very easy cleansing.

A container wrench:


This is one more device that should remain in every residence. When doing plumbing fixings, it might be needed to chill out bolts and sink plumbing components. The basin wrench makes this feasible as well as is likewise utilized to tighten up nuts. This wrench has a head that rotates at the back as well as front. This assists to reach smaller nuts or hold the tap handles as well as pipelines.

Pliers:


The kind of pliers advised for plumbing is the tongue-and-groove pliers. Pliers are really beneficial devices for DIY plumbing technicians.

Teflon tape:


This is also typically called plumber's tape. It is utilized to securely seal pile joints and fitting. The tapes are in rolls reduced to certain dimensions as well as widths. It is an impervious seal as well as as a result of this, it can be used to hold back leakages till specialist aid arrives.

Bettor:


Bettor is an extremely excellent device for solving plumbing issues. It is made use of to clear clogs in commodes, kitchen sinks, as well as various other drains pipes in your home.

8 Must Have Plumbing Tools for Homeowners


A CUP PLUNGER


Did you know there are different types of plungers? They are all made to remove clogs, but some work better for different types of jobs. A cup plunger is the plunger with the traditional design that most people are familiar with. It is essentially a rubber cup on the end of a stick. Some have short plastic handles and others long wooden ones. It is designed to unclog drains that sit on a flat surface such as those found in bathtubs, sinks or showers. You simply lay the cup flat over the drain and push straight down to make the seal. Pull the stick up to create negative pressure to remove the clog from your plumbing system. You may have to work your cup plunger for a while depending on the stubbornness of the clog.


A FLANGE PLUNGER


A flange plunger is another member of the plunger family, but it is made to do different work than its cousin, the cup plunger. The flange plunger has a wooden stick and a rubber base with a cup formation at the bottom of it. This makes it easier to fit into a toilet’s drain and remove debris that is clogging the pipe. The design of this plunger also makes it useful for unclogging sinks. But, it’s best to have a separate plunger to use for your sinks and toilets. You don’t want to spread germs and bacteria by using one plunger for every item in your home.


A PIPE WRENCH


A pipe wrench is a valuable item to have in your collection of tools. It is a durable tool that should last you for years. The width of its serrated jaws can be adjusted to get a firm grip on all types of pipes. So, when you install a pipe under a sink or elsewhere, a pipe wrench can help you ensure that the connection is tight. Or, if you have to take out a pipe that needs to be replaced due to wear & tear over the years, a pipe wrench allows you to get a solid hold on the pipe in order to disconnect it from other connections. If you’re in the market for a new pipe wrench, take some time to try some in-person. Pick up a few in the store to a get a feel for the grip and weight of the tool. This can help you to select one that you’re comfortable using.


PLUMBERS PUTTY


A tube or container of plumber’s putty is another must-have for your tool box. It looks just like regular putty but is used to make a seal that is water tight. You may apply it around a faucet or put some around a drain in a bathroom sink. This putty serves as an extra barrier to prevent leaks.
